Ex HVAC tech (UK based) I actually preferred it as an apprentice as he was really invested in his business and due to it being only me and him he was able to take time and teach me everything correctly. Whereas when I worked for a larger FM company as an apprentice I struggled to learn anything at all as everything was rushed and all jobs were deadlined so the technicians I was out with took absolutely no interest.
